They will do four performances at Zellerbach Hall at Berkeley May 31-June 4:
http://www.calperfs....1/dance/rdb.php

It appears that tickets are already on sale.

I tried comparing programs announced for the various cities.
At Berkeley:
Program A (Tue & Wed): Bournonville: La Sylphide, music by H. S. Løvenskiold · Flindt: The Lesson, music by George Delerue

Program B (Fri & Sat): Nordic Modern Choreography: Jorma Uotinen: Earth, music by Metallica and Apocalyptica · Thomas Lund and Nikolaj Hübbe: Bournonville Variations, set to music by Martin Åkerwall, from the Bournonville Classes · Johan Kobbog: Alumnus, music by H. Wieniawski-Kreisler, Hans Christian Lumbye · Jorma Elo: Lost on Slow, music by Antonio Vivaldi

At OCPAC:
http://www.scfta.org....aspx?NavID=796
Program I: May 24, 25
Nordic Choreography Project - A unique program of new works created by four great Nordic choreographers: Kim Brandstrup, Johan Kobborg, Pontus Linberg and Jorma Uotinen

Program II: May 27-29
Napoli - The company performs one of August Bournonville's most beloved comic ballets in a brand new production by artistic director Nicolaj Hübbe

At the Kennedy Center:
http://www.kennedy-c...ent&event=BLBSH
A Folk Tale:
Tue.–Thu., June 7–9 at 7:30 p.m.

Napoli:
Fri. & Sat., June 10 & 11 at 7:30 p.m.
Sat. & Sun., June 11 & 12 at 1:30 p.m.

They seem to be varying their programs around the country, so it's impossible to guess what they'll present in New York June 14-19. Nothing announced yet on the Koch Theatre site:
